Fish Die off – Lake Ontario

This issue was brought to Councillor Dasko’s attention last week (Week of April 28th) and he had asked staff to investigate.

Staff in Animal Services reached out to the Ministry of Natural Resources to investigate.  MNR has advised that this is a natural occurrence due to the change in the water temperature at this time of the year.  Apparently this particular species is susceptible to stress caused by the change in temperature.

To report a fish die-off in Ontario, you can contact the Ministry of Natural Resources and Forestry (MNR) at 1-800-387-7011.
